WebAlso remember not to put a space between the last word in the complete sentence and the first period. At the beginning of a sentence. Use an ellipsis at the beginning of a sentence when you cut out the beginning of a quote. If the quote starts in the middle of a sentence, remember not to start the quote with a capital letter.

WebCapitalize the first letter of a direct quote when the quoted material is a complete sentence. Mr. Johnson, who was working in his field that morning, said, "The alien spaceship …

WebDec 23, 2024 · In American English, use double quotes for the outside quote and single quotes for the inside quote. In British English, do the opposite. You may also use an ellipsis between quoted sentences to indicate that a sentence or sentences were omitted. sh script rename fileWebA signal phrase shows who is speaking when a quote is included in a sentence. Signal phrases can be placed at the beginning of a sentence, the middle of a sentence, or the end of a sentence.
